20 de jun. de 2024 · Boy George (born June 14, 1961, London, England) is a British singer-songwriter, best known as the lead singer of the British new wave band Culture Club, which rose to fame in the early 1980s. Boy George, known for his androgynous appearance, with often flamboyant makeup and clothing, was a trailblazing icon of 1980s music and fashion.

23 de jun. de 2024 · Gay hero songwriter and pioneer of the gender bending aesthetic, Boy George, was interviewed for the BBC 4 Television programme "This Cultural Life" on April 4th. George revealed that he was not interested in writing another "Karma Chameleon" hit single and said that he was very much a "now person", enjoying song writing in the present.

Born as George Alan O’Dowd at Barnehurst Hospital in Bexley, Kent on June 14, 1961, George became a follower of the English New Romantics movement which was popular in Britain during the early Eighties. He lived in various squats around Warren Street in Central London.
